Series and Events

  • Series and Events in Dressage

    Dressage, the highest expression of horse training, is considered to be the art of equestrian sport and is used as the groundwork for all the other disciplines. In 2010, there were 376 Dressage and 17 Para-Equestrian Dressage International Events held around the world (for more statistics, check out the FEI Annual Report. To find out about dates and venues of International Dressage & Para-Equestrian Dressage events around the world, use the FEI Search Centre. The premier Dressage & Para-Equestrian Dressage events (Games, Championships and Series) are: 

    Olympic & Paralympic Games
    The Olympic & Paralympic Games take place every four years in a bissextile year. The last editions were held in Hong Kong (CHN) in 2008. The next Games will be staged in 2012 in London (GBR). For more information on the Olympic Games, click here, and for the Paralympic Games, click here.

    Alltech FEI World Equestrian Games™
    The FEI World Equestrian Games™ are held every four years in the even years between the Olympic Games. In 2010, the Games did cross the Atlantic for the very first time and were held in Kentucky (USA). For more information, click here. The next Games will be staged in 2014 in Basse-Normandie (FRA).

    Reem Acra FEI World Cup™ Dressage
    Since its creation in 1985, the FEI World Cup™ Dressage series has been the climax of the indoor season drawing ever greater spectator interest wherever the competitions play out around the world. Riders from four different leagues will be attempting to qualify for the 2011/2012 FEI World Cup™ Final in 's Hertogenbosch (NED). For more information, visit the dedicated hub here.
